Understanding Tattoo Removal Costs: What Affects the Price?

When considering laser tattoo removal, one of the first questions that comes to mind is: How much will it cost? The answer varies from person to person, as multiple factors influence the price of each session and the total treatment plan. Let’s break down what determines the cost so you can better understand what to expect.

1. Tattoo Size & Complexity

The size of your tattoo is one of the biggest factors affecting cost. Smaller tattoos (like finger or wrist tattoos) require less time and fewer laser pulses, while larger pieces (such as full sleeves or back tattoos) naturally require longer sessions and more treatments.

General cost breakdown by tattoo size:

  • Small tattoos (1-3 inches): Lower cost per session, fewer treatments needed
  • Medium tattoos (4-6 inches): Moderate pricing with more sessions required
  • Large tattoos (7+ inches): Higher cost due to increased treatment area and complexity

2. Ink Colors & Density

Not all tattoo inks are created equal. Darker ink, like black and deep blue, absorbs laser energy easily, making it the quickest to fade. Lighter colors, such as yellow, green, and white, reflect more light, requiring more sessions for full removal. 3. Number of Sessions Required

Most tattoos require 5 to 10 sessions for complete removal, but this varies based on factors like:

  • Tattoo age – Older tattoos tend to fade faster
  • Ink depth – Professionally done tattoos have deeper ink layers
  • Skin type – Some skin tones require more gradual treatment for safety
  • Your body’s healing response – A healthy immune system clears ink faster

4. Tattoo Location

Where your tattoo is placed on your body can affect both cost and the number of sessions needed. Areas with better blood circulation (like the arms, chest, and upper back) typically fade more quickly, while areas with less circulation (like fingers, ankles, and feet) may require additional treatments.

5. Professional vs. Amateur Tattoos

Professional tattoos tend to use high-quality ink and precise techniques, meaning they often require more treatments to break down the pigment effectively. On the other hand, amateur tattoos may use uneven layers of ink, which can sometimes lead to faster removal—but also unpredictable fading patterns.

Average Cost of Laser Tattoo Removal: What to Expect

Understanding the investment involved in tattoo removal can help you plan your journey with confidence. While pricing varies based on your tattoo’s size, color, and complexity, here’s a general idea of what you might expect to pay per session:

 Estimated Cost Per Session by Tattoo Size:

  • Small tattoos (1-3 inches): $100 - $250 per session
  • Medium tattoos (4-6 inches): $200 - $500 per session
  • Large tattoos (7+ inches): $400 - $1,000+ per session

Since most tattoos require 5-10 sessions, the total cost for complete removal can range from $500 for a small tattoo to several thousand dollars for large, complex designs. However, some people only need partial fading for a cover-up, which may reduce the number of sessions needed.

The Science Behind Laser Tattoo Removal

The Sharplight Omnimax S4 Laser emits precise wavelengths of light that target the ink particles embedded in your skin. When these light pulses strike the ink, they fragment the pigment into smaller particles. Over time, your body's natural lymphatic system processes and eliminates these fragmented ink particles, leading to the gradual fading and eventual disappearance of the tattoo.

2. Does laser tattoo removal hurt?

Pain tolerance varies from person to person, but many clients describe the sensation as similar to a rubber band snapping against the skin. The good news is that our Sharplight Omnimax S4 Laser is designed with a built-in cooling system, which helps minimize discomfort.

For those with low pain tolerance, we can also apply a topical numbing cream before treatment to make the session more comfortable.

3. How many sessions will I need to remove my tattoo?

Most tattoos require 5 to 10 sessions, but the exact number depends on:
Tattoo age – Older tattoos tend to fade faster
Ink density & color – Darker inks respond quicker than lighter shades like green and yellow
Tattoo placement – Areas with higher blood circulation (e.g., arms, chest) fade faster
Your body’s healing response – A healthy immune system helps clear ink more efficiently

Sessions are typically spaced 6 to 8 weeks apart to allow your body to naturally break down and eliminate the fragmented ink particles.

4. Can all ink colors be removed?

Yes, but some colors require more sessions than others. The Sharplight Omnimax S4 Laser is highly effective at treating a wide range of ink colors, including:

Black & dark blue ink – Easiest to remove
Red, orange & purple ink – Usually fade well
Green & yellow ink – Require more sessions but can still be treated
White ink – Can be the most challenging, as it reflects light rather than absorbing it

5. Will laser tattoo removal leave scars?

When performed by trained professionals, laser tattoo removal should not leave scars. The Sharplight Omnimax S4 Laser is designed to target ink without damaging the surrounding skin, reducing the risk of scarring. To further minimize risks:

  • Follow aftercare instructions carefully
  • Avoid picking at scabs or blisters
  • Stay out of direct sunlight and wear SPF 50+ on the treated area

If your tattoo already has scarring from previous tattooing, it will remain after the ink is removed, but laser treatments may help improve skin texture over time.

6. How long should I wait between sessions?

Each session should be spaced 6 to 8 weeks apart to give your body time to clear the ink naturally. Rushing the process can lead to unnecessary skin irritation or damage.

7. Are there any side effects of laser tattoo removal?

Laser tattoo removal is safe when performed by trained professionals, but some temporary side effects are normal, including:

  • Redness and swelling – Usually fades within a few hours to days
  • Blistering or scabbing – A natural part of the healing process
  • Temporary darkening or lightening of the skin – Fades over time as the skin heals

Our team at Skin Designer Lounge provides detailed aftercare guidance to ensure a smooth recovery.

8. Is laser tattoo removal safe for all skin types?

Yes! However, different skin tones require adjustments to the laser settings to prevent unwanted pigmentation changes.

Lighter skin tones typically respond faster to treatment
Darker skin tones require lower energy settings to prevent hyperpigmentation or hypopigmentation

10. What should I do before and after my tattoo removal session?

Before Treatment:

 Avoid sun exposure for 2 weeks before your session
 Stay hydrated and keep the skin moisturized
 Do not apply lotions, makeup, or perfumes to the tattooed area on treatment day

After Treatment:

Keep the area clean and apply any recommended healing ointments
Avoid direct sun exposure and use SPF 50+ on the treated area
Do not pick at any scabs or blisters to prevent scarring
Avoid strenuous exercise or swimming for 48 hours

Following these simple steps will ensure the best results and a smooth healing process.
